What is NFC Technology?

NFC stands for Near Field Communication, a technology that enables two devices to communicate when in close proximity, typically within a few centimeters. This technology has become increasingly popular in smartwatches, allowing for seamless transactions, data exchanges, and connections. NFC operates on a simple principle: when two devices are close enough, they can “talk” to each other, facilitating quick and easy data transfer.

Smartwatches equipped with NFC technology offer endless possibilities. Whether you are making contactless payments, sharing files, or unlocking devices, NFC enhances the functionality of smartwatches. Major players like Apple, Google, and Samsung integrate NFC into their devices, cementing its importance in the wearable technology landscape.

The Role of NFC in Contactless Payments

One of the most prominent benefits of NFC technology in smartwatches is the ability to make contactless payments. Users can link their credit or debit cards to their smartwatches, allowing for quick transactions at various merchants.

How Does It Work?

When you approach a payment terminal with your NFC-enabled smartwatch, the device communicates with the terminal using encrypted data. This ensures that your financial information remains secure, making NFC a trustworthy option for payments. Many individuals prefer this method due to its speed and convenience, eliminating the need to carry physical cards.

Real-Life Examples

Leading platforms such as Apple Pay and Google Wallet make use of NFC technology for contactless payments. With just a tap of the wrist, users can efficiently complete transactions, highlighting the convenience and ease of use of smartwatches equipped with NFC.

Enhanced Security Features

NFC technology also offers advanced security features. Transactions made via NFC are generally more secure than traditional payment methods.

Data Encryption

By utilizing encryption, NFC technology ensures that sensitive information remains safe from unauthorized access. This is crucial in an age where data breaches are common.

Biometric Authentication

Many smartwatches incorporate biometric security, such as fingerprint scanning or facial recognition. This adds an extra layer of security for transactions, making NFC-enabled smartwatches one of the safest options for mobile payments.

Use Cases of NFC Technology in Smartwatches

Beyond payments, NFC technology opens doors to various use cases that enhance user experience in smartwatches.

Sharing Data

Smartwatches can utilize NFC to share files, such as contacts or photos, with other NFC-enabled devices. This simplifies the process of transferring information, saving users time and effort.

Access Control

NFC technology allows users to unlock doors or access secure locations effortlessly. Companies often implement NFC in employee ID cards, and with smartwatches, users can enjoy similar access capabilities.

Fitness and Health Applications

Many fitness enthusiasts benefit from NFC technology in smartwatches. Users can easily track workouts and share data with fitness equipment like gym machines equipped with NFC. This creates a seamless workout experience.

Comparisons: NFC vs. Other Technologies

When considering smartwatches, NFC stands out compared to other wireless technologies like Bluetooth or RFID.

Speed and Convenience

NFC is faster than Bluetooth, as it doesn’t require pairing or lengthy connections. Users can make a payment or share data almost instantaneously.

Battery Consumption

NFC technology is designed to consume minimal battery power. In comparison, Bluetooth tends to drain battery life faster, especially with continuous usage.

Common Mistakes When Using NFC

While NFC technology offers numerous advantages, users should be aware of common mistakes to ensure optimal performance.

Ignoring Software Updates

Smartwatch manufacturers often push software updates that enhance NFC functionality. Failing to update your device can lead to security vulnerabilities and a subpar user experience.

Misunderstanding Coverage Area

NFC requires close proximity for successful communication. Some users mistakenly believe they can perform transactions from a distance, leading to frustration and inefficiency.

FAQs

What are the main benefits of NFC technology in smartwatches?

NFC technology enables contactless payments, quick data sharing, enhanced security features, and access control, making smartwatches more functional and convenient.

How do I know if my smartwatch has NFC capabilities?

Most manufacturers clearly indicate NFC capabilities in the device specifications. Check your smartwatch’s user manual or official website for details.

Can NFC technology work with any smartphone?

For NFC technology to function properly, both devices must be NFC-enabled. Most modern smartphones support NFC.

Is NFC technology safe for payments?

Yes, NFC technology employs encryption and often requires biometric authentication, making it a secure method for transactions.

What happens if my smartwatch runs out of battery?

If a smartwatch with NFC runs out of battery, it will lose all functionalities, including NFC capabilities. Regular charging is necessary to maintain operation.
